minecraft:mossy_stone_brick_slabMossy Stone Brick Slab is the half-height slab form of Mossy Stone Bricks, giving builders a moss-flecked, half-block surface for steps and detailing that matches the ruined-portal aesthetic.

Uses
- Decorative flooring and steps — Two slabs stacked form a full block visually identical to Mossy Stone Bricks, useful for half-height detailing in ruined or overgrown builds.
Found In
- Ruined portals — Generates naturally as part of ruined portal structures in the Overworld.
- Crafted from Mossy Stone Bricks — Three Mossy Stone Bricks in a row yield six slabs, or one block on a stonecutter yields two.

FAQ
What tool do I need to mine Mossy Stone Brick Slab?
Any pickaxe, wood tier or better. Mining without one drops nothing.
Does it drop itself when mined?
Yes, always one Mossy Stone Brick Slab per layer, unaffected by Silk Touch or Fortune.
Where can I find this without crafting it?
It generates naturally as part of ruined portals scattered across the Overworld.
Is Mossy Stone Brick Slab renewable?
No. Mossy Stone Bricks themselves are not renewable, so the slab crafted from them is not renewable either.
